Understanding Mix & Match Bundle Pricing, Discounts, and Rewards
uShopAid’s Mix & Match Bundle supports multiple pricing, discount, and reward strategies.
You can create offers such as:
- Tiered discounts that reward customers for adding more products
- Percentage discounts triggered by quantity or Bundle subtotal
- Specific Bundle prices after customers meet a condition
- Free gifts after customers meet a condition
- Free shipping after customers meet a condition
- A fixed-price Box containing a set number of products
- Multiple Boxes with different sizes and prices
- A gift list that lets customers choose their preferred free gifts
These settings do not all belong to the same level.
Before configuring an offer, first determine whether you are using Buy more save more or Single-box / Multi-box, and then configure the corresponding pricing, discounts, and rewards.
1. Choose your Bundle pricing structure
Mix & Match Bundle uses two different pricing and discount systems:
Bundle type | Setup method | Best for |
|---|---|---|
Buy more save more | Discount rules | Creating one or more offers based on product quantity or Bundle subtotal |
Single-box / Multi-box | Box size & price | Offering one or more Boxes with fixed sizes and prices |
Buy more save more
Buy more save more uses Discount rules.
Each Discount rule can contain:
- A Discount type
- A Discount based on setting
- A qualifying threshold
- Required products, optional
- Other combinable benefits, optional
You can create multiple Discount rules and arrange them from the lowest qualifying threshold to the highest.
For example:
- Add 2 products → 10% off
- Add 4 products → 15% off + a free gift
- Add 6 products → 20% off + a free gift + free shipping
Single-box / Multi-box
Single-box and Multi-box use the same Box size & price settings.
The only difference is the number of Boxes offered:
- Single-box provides one Box.
- Multi-box provides multiple Boxes for customers to choose from.
For example:
Single-box:
- Choose any 4 products
- Fixed price: $199
Multi-box:
- 3 products for $59
- 4 products for $119
- 6 products for $139
Each Box can have its own:
- Size
- Price
- Compare-at price
- Fixed free gifts
- Gift quantities
2. How Buy more save more Discount rules work
A complete Discount rule usually contains:
- A Discount type
- A Discount based on setting
- A qualifying threshold
- Required products, optional
- Other combinable benefits, optional

Choose what the rule is based on
Use Discount based on to determine what triggers the rule.
Available options include:
- Quantity — Based on the number of products added to the Bundle
- Bundle subtotal — Based on the subtotal of the products in the Bundle
For example:
- The quantity added to the Bundle is greater than or equal to 3
- The Bundle subtotal is greater than or equal to $100
When customers meet the requirement, the offer configured in that Discount rule becomes available.
3. Discount types supported by Buy more save more
Use Discount type to choose the main offer provided by the rule.
Supported Discount types include:
- Percentage off
- Amount off
- Specific price
- Cheapest item discount
- Most expensive item discount
- Free gift
- Free shipping
Percentage off
Apply a percentage discount to the products in the Bundle.
For example:
- Add 2 products → 10% off
- Add 4 products → 15% off
- Add 6 products → 20% off
Best for:
- Buy more save more campaigns
- Encouraging customers to add more products
- Creating clear tiered offers
Amount off
Subtract a fixed amount from the Bundle price.
For example:
- Add 3 products → $10 off
- Add 5 products → $25 off
- Add 8 products → $50 off
Best for:
- Higher-priced products
- Promotions that emphasize a clear savings amount
- Higher-value Bundles
Specific price
Set the Bundle to a specific price after customers meet the requirement.
For example:
- Add 3 products → Bundle price is $99
- Add 5 products → Bundle price is $149
You can create multiple Discount rules to assign different specific prices to different quantity or subtotal thresholds.
For example:
- Add 3 products → $99
- Add 6 products → $179
- Add 10 products → $249
Cheapest item discount
Apply a discount to the lowest-priced product in the current Bundle.
For example:
- Make the cheapest product free
- Apply 50% off to the cheapest product
Best for:
- Buy X Get One Free offers
- Encouraging customers to add another product
- Applying a promotion to the lowest-priced product
Most expensive item discount
Apply a discount to the highest-priced product in the current Bundle.
For example:
- Apply 20% off to the most expensive product
- Make the most expensive product free
Best for:
- Promoting higher-value products
- Higher-value promotions
- Applying an offer to the highest-priced product
Free gift
Free gift is an independent Discount type.
After selecting Free gift, you can configure:
- Whether the rule is based on Quantity or Bundle subtotal
- The qualifying threshold
- The gift products
- The quantity of each gift
For example:
- Add 3 products → Receive product A for free
- Add 5 products → Receive products A and B for free
- Spend $150 → Receive a free gift
This rule does not need to include a percentage or amount discount. The free gift itself can be the main offer.

Free shipping
Free shipping is also an independent Discount type.
After selecting Free shipping, you can configure the required product quantity or Bundle subtotal.
For example:
- Add 3 products → Receive free shipping
- Add 5 products → Receive free shipping
- Spend $100 → Receive free shipping
This rule does not need to include another price discount. Free shipping itself can be the main offer.

4. Required products
Required products is an additional condition for a Discount rule.
It is not a Discount type or a reward.
When Required products is enabled, customers must meet the quantity or Bundle subtotal requirement and add the specified products before the rule can apply.
For example:
- Add 3 products and include product A → Receive 15% off
- Add 5 products and include products A and B → Receive $30 off
- Add 4 products and include a specified product → Receive a free gift
- Add 6 products and include a specified product → Receive free shipping
Best for:
- Promoting specific product combinations
- Creating complementary product offers
- Requiring certain products to be included in a promotion
- Offering different rewards for different product combinations
5. Combine multiple benefits
Free gift and Free shipping can be used as independent Discount types, and they can also be combined with other offers.
The available combination options depend on the selected Discount type.
Examples include:
- Percentage off + Free gift
- Percentage off + Free shipping
- Percentage off + Free gift + Free shipping
- Amount off + Free gift
- Specific price + Free gift
- Free gift + Free shipping
- Free shipping + Free gift
For example, a combined rule could be:
Add 4 products and include a specified product to receive 20% off, a free gift, and free shipping.
Free gift and Free shipping therefore have two possible roles in Buy more save more:
Feature | Can be an independent Discount type | Can be combined with another offer |
|---|---|---|
Free gift | Yes | Yes |
Free shipping | Yes | Yes |
6. Create multiple Buy more save more tiers
Buy more save more can contain multiple Discount rules.
Arrange the rules from the lowest qualifying threshold to the highest.
For example:
Discount rule | Requirement | Discount type | Other benefits |
|---|---|---|---|
Rule 1 | Add 2 products | Percentage off: 10% | None |
Rule 2 | Add 4 products | Percentage off: 15% | Free gift |
Rule 3 | Add 6 products | Percentage off: 20% | Free gift + Free shipping |
You can also create rules that provide rewards without reducing product prices: | |||
Discount rule | Requirement | Discount type | Other benefits |
---- | --- | --- | --- |
Rule 1 | Add 3 products | Free gift | None |
Rule 2 | Add 5 products | Free shipping | Free gift |
This setup encourages customers to add more products to unlock higher discount or reward tiers. |
7. How Single-box and Multi-box work
Single-box and Multi-box do not use Buy more save more Discount rules.
They are configured under:
Discounts → Box size & price
Single-box
Single-box provides one fixed Box.
For example:
- Choose any 4 products
- Fixed price: $199
- Compare-at price: $299
- Free gift: Sample Nail Lamp × 1
Customers must complete the required product selection for the Box before completing the Bundle.
Best for:
- Choose-any-X offers
- Fixed-price Bundles
- Gift sets
- Product packs
Multi-box
Multi-box provides multiple Boxes for customers to choose from.
For example:
- Basic: 3 products for $59
- Standard: 4 products for $119
- Premium: 6 products for $139
Customers first choose a Box and then select the required number of products for the selected Box.
Each Box can have its own:
- Size
- Price
- Compare-at price
- Fixed free gifts
- Gift quantities
Best for:
- Offering multiple Bundle sizes
- Serving customers with different budgets or quantity needs
- Family packs or larger product sets
- Multiple fixed-price options
8. Understanding free gifts
Mix & Match Bundle supports two different free gift experiences:
- Fixed free gifts
- Customer-selected free gifts
Fixed free gifts
A fixed free gift is predefined by the merchant.
When customers qualify, they receive the specified gift and cannot replace it with another product.
The setup location depends on the Bundle type:
Bundle type | Fixed free gift setup |
|---|---|
Buy more save more | Discount rules → Discount type: Free gift, or enable Free gift inside another Discount type |
Single-box / Multi-box | Box size & price → Offer free gift with this box |
Fixed free gifts in Buy more save more
A fixed free gift can be:
- The independent Free gift Discount type
- Combined with Percentage off, Amount off, Specific price, or another available offer
Customers receive the fixed gift after meeting the quantity or Bundle subtotal requirement.
Fixed free gifts in Single-box / Multi-box
The gift is assigned directly to a Box.
Customers receive the gift configured for that Box after completing the required selection for the selected Box.
Different Boxes in a Multi-box Bundle can include different gifts.
Choose how fixed free gifts are added
Use Free gift behavior to decide how the gift is added after customers qualify.
Show Popup
Select:
Show Popup – Let customers know they've received a free gift
When customers qualify for the gift, a popup appears to let them know that they have received a free gift.
After they confirm the popup, the gift is added to the Bundle Summary.
Add Automatically
Select:
Add Automatically – Add the gift silently without a popup
When customers qualify for the gift, no popup appears. The gift is added directly to the Bundle Summary.
Free gift behavior | Popup shown? | How the gift is added |
|---|---|---|
Show Popup | Yes | Added to the Bundle Summary after the customer confirms |
Add Automatically | No | Added directly to the Bundle Summary |
Display fixed gifts directly in two special templates
Single-box and Multi-box each include one special Product page embed template that can display the fixed gifts included with the current Box directly on the Bundle page through the Included products component.
Bundle type | Template | Fixed gift display |
|---|---|---|
Single-box | Fixed Design Set | Included products |
Multi-box | Selectable Design Set | Included products |
Other templates use Free gift behavior to show a popup or add the gift automatically. | ||
In both cases, the gift will appear in the Bundle Summary. | ||

Customer-selected free gifts
If you do not want to assign one specific fixed gift in advance, use Choose free gift / Free gift list to let customers select from multiple available gifts.
This method does not require you to assign one specific fixed gift through Discount rules or Box settings.
You can configure:
- The products available as gifts
- How many gifts customers can select
- The requirements customers must meet before choosing gifts
For example:
- Choose 1 gift from 5 available gifts
- Choose 2 gifts from 10 available gifts
- Complete the Bundle selection, then choose the allowed number of free gifts
Comparison | Fixed free gift | Customer-selected free gift |
|---|---|---|
Who decides the gift? | The merchant | The customer |
Is a specific gift assigned in advance? | Yes | No; the merchant defines the available options |
Where is it configured? | Discount rules or Box settings | Choose free gift / Free gift list |
Can customers choose? | No | Yes, from the available gift options |
Best for | Providing a predetermined gift | Providing a more flexible gift experience |
9. Choose the right discount or reward
What you want to achieve | Recommended setup |
|---|---|
Give customers a larger discount as they add more products | Buy more save more + Percentage off |
Subtract a fixed amount after customers qualify | Buy more save more + Amount off |
Set a specific total price after customers qualify | Buy more save more + Specific price |
Make the cheapest product free or discounted | Buy more save more + Cheapest item discount |
Discount the most expensive product | Buy more save more + Most expensive item discount |
Give only a specific gift after customers qualify | Buy more save more + Discount type: Free gift |
Add a gift to another discount | Enable Free gift in the applicable Discount rule |
Provide only free shipping after customers qualify | Buy more save more + Discount type: Free shipping |
Add free shipping to another offer | Enable Free shipping in the applicable Discount rule |
Require specific products for an offer | Required products |
Let customers choose from multiple gifts | Choose free gift / Free gift list |
Offer one Box with a fixed size and price | Single-box |
Offer multiple Boxes for customers to choose from | Multi-box |
Frequently asked questions
Is Free gift an independent Discount type?
Yes.
In Buy more save more, Free gift can be the independent Discount type of a Discount rule.
For example:
Add 4 products to receive a free gift.
Free gift can also be combined with other Discount types, such as:
- Percentage off + Free gift
- Amount off + Free gift
- Specific price + Free gift
- Free gift + Free shipping
Is Free shipping an independent Discount type?
Yes.
Free shipping can be the independent Discount type of a Discount rule, and it can also be combined with another discount or a free gift.
What is the difference between Specific price and Single-box?
Specific price is a Discount type used by Buy more save more.
It applies only after customers meet the requirement of the corresponding Discount rule.
Single-box directly provides one fixed Box size and price. It does not use Buy more save more Discount rules.
Do Single-box and Multi-box use the same settings?
Yes.
Both use Box size & price to configure the Size, Price, Compare-at price, and fixed free gifts.
The difference is:
- Single-box provides one Box.
- Multi-box provides multiple Boxes for customers to choose from.
Is Required products a Discount type?
No.
Required products is an additional condition for a Discount rule.
Customers must meet the quantity or subtotal requirement and add the specified products before the rule’s discounts and rewards can apply.
What is the difference between a fixed free gift and a customer-selected free gift?
A fixed free gift is predefined by the merchant, and customers cannot replace it.
Customer-selected free gifts use Choose free gift / Free gift list to provide multiple gift options and let customers select the allowed number of gifts.
Why is my fixed free gift not displayed?
Check the following:
- Confirm that the gift is configured in the correct Discount rule or Box.
- Confirm that the customer has met the applicable quantity, subtotal, or Box requirement.
- Check whether Free gift behavior is set to Show Popup or Add Automatically.
- If you are using Fixed Design Set or Selectable Design Set, check the Included products component and its Source type.
